diff --git a/drivers/xen/xen-selfballoon.c b/drivers/xen/xen-selfballoon.c index 21e18c18c7a..3b2bffde534 100644 --- a/drivers/xen/xen-selfballoon.c +++ b/drivers/xen/xen-selfballoon.c @@ -170,11 +170,13 @@ static void frontswap_selfshrink(void)  		tgt_frontswap_pages = cur_frontswap_pages -  			(cur_frontswap_pages / frontswap_hysteresis);  	frontswap_shrink(tgt_frontswap_pages); +	frontswap_inertia_counter = frontswap_inertia;  }  #endif /* CONFIG_FRONTSWAP */  #define MB2PAGES(mb)	((mb) << (20 - PAGE_SHIFT)) +#define PAGES2MB(pages) ((pages) >> (20 - PAGE_SHIFT))  /*   * Use current balloon size, the goal (vm_committed_as), and hysteresis @@ -525,6 +527,7 @@ EXPORT_SYMBOL(register_xen_selfballooning);  int xen_selfballoon_init(bool use_selfballooning, bool use_frontswap_selfshrink)  {  	bool enable = false; +	unsigned long reserve_pages;  	if (!xen_domain())  		return -ENODEV; @@ -549,6 +552,26 @@ int xen_selfballoon_init(bool use_selfballooning, bool use_frontswap_selfshrink)  	if (!enable)  		return -ENODEV; +	/* +	 * Give selfballoon_reserved_mb a default value(10% of total ram pages) +	 * to make selfballoon not so aggressive. +	 * +	 * There are mainly two reasons: +	 * 1) The original goal_page didn't consider some pages used by kernel +	 *    space, like slab pages and memory used by device drivers. +	 * +	 * 2) The balloon driver may not give back memory to guest OS fast +	 *    enough when the workload suddenly aquries a lot of physical memory. +	 * +	 * In both cases, the guest OS will suffer from memory pressure and +	 * OOM killer may be triggered. +	 * By reserving extra 10% of total ram pages, we can keep the system +	 * much more reliably and response faster in some cases. +	 */ +	if (!selfballoon_reserved_mb) { +		reserve_pages = totalram_pages / 10; +		selfballoon_reserved_mb = PAGES2MB(reserve_pages); +	}  	schedule_delayed_work(&selfballoon_worker, selfballoon_interval * HZ);  	return 0;  |
